In the end, I did not try that, but I witnessed the same issue with another software :

- when trying to play a video (yes I know, it's not appropriate in the x2go +WLAN context. But it's not the point) with VLC, and it's failing with the same error. - when trying to play the same video with "parole", it's working (it's lagging forever, but not crashing) - when trying to display the same pictures folder as with gthumb, but with "ristretto", it is working.

So what is the common point between :
- crashing gthumb and vlc
- working parole and ristretto
?

Before crashing, vlc (launched via xterm) gives lot of information that will be useful to more-skilled-than-me coders :

$ vlc ./20191009_214537_small.jpg
VLC media player 3.0.8 Vetinari (revision 3.0.8-0-gf350b6b5a7)
[000055d437f7f5b0] main libvlc: Lancement de vlc avec l'interface par défaut. Utiliser « cvlc » pour démarrer VLC sans interface.
qt.qpa.xcb: X server does not support XInput 2
qt.glx: qglx_findConfig: Failed to finding matching FBConfig (8 8 8 0)
qt.glx: qglx_findConfig: Failed to finding matching FBConfig (1 8 8 0)
qt.glx: qglx_findConfig: Failed to finding matching FBConfig (1 1 8 0)
qt.glx: qglx_findConfig: Failed to finding matching FBConfig (1 1 1 0)
qt.glx: qglx_findConfig: Failed to finding matching FBConfig (1 1 1 0)
No XVisualInfo for format QSurfaceFormat(version 2.0, options QFlags<QSurfaceFormat::FormatOption>(), depthBufferSize -1, redBufferSize 1, greenBufferSize 1, blueBufferSize 1, alphaBufferSize -1, stencilBufferSize -1, samples -1, swapBehavior QSurfaceFormat::SingleBuffer, swapInterval 1, colorSpace QSurfaceFormat::DefaultColorSpace, profile QSurfaceFormat::NoProfile)
Falling back to using screens root_visual.
[... repeating the errors above 10 times]
free(): double free detected in tcache 2
Abandon (core dumped)

Does that give any useful hint?
